Output 06c56a94dc50ae715596086157d67f60005e7817ca10d5b4f11574a56fa069f0:0

value
3037756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b12ed05a9c986721b934c1b519eddc0e42692309 OP_EQUAL
address
3HqscBaxp4CRXsWQrLtEdVUK9R7hz8d2om
transaction
06c56a94dc50ae715596086157d67f60005e7817ca10d5b4f11574a56fa069f0
confirmations
174146
spent
true